Product Overview

Medcomic
Medcomic

Description: Medcomic is a free web-based tool for creating custom medical and health-related comics. It has a drag-and-drop comic builder with pre-made backgrounds, characters, props, and text bubbles that allow non-artists to easily create simple comics for patient education, public health campaigns, medical training, and more.

Type: software

Picmonic
Picmonic

Description: Picmonic is a learning and memory tool that uses pictures and stories to help students and professionals memorize and retain information for tests or work. It can be used to study subjects like anatomy, pharmacology, biology, and more.

Type: software

Key Features Comparison

Medcomic
Medcomic Features
  • Drag-and-drop comic builder
  • Pre-made backgrounds, characters, props, and text bubbles
  • Allows non-artists to easily create simple comics
  • Can be used for patient education, public health campaigns, medical training, and more
Picmonic
Picmonic Features
  • Uses pictures and stories to help memorize information
  • Covers many academic subjects like anatomy, pharmacology, biology, etc
  • Has audio narration to explain the Picmonics (picture mnemonics)
  • Offers practice questions and assessments
  • Provides flashcards for reviewing content
  • Has mobile apps available

Pros & Cons Analysis

Medcomic
Medcomic
Pros
  • Free to use
  • Simple and easy to use interface
  • Good selection of pre-made assets to build comics
  • Allows customization for different needs and topics
  • Promotes visual storytelling for engaging communication
Cons
  • Limited customization options compared to full drawing software
  • May not allow extremely detailed or complex comics
  • Requires internet access to use web app
  • Comics are not downloadable or sharable
Picmonic
Picmonic
Pros
  • Engaging way to memorize facts and concepts
  • Caters to visual learners
  • Entertaining and humorous Picmonics make content stick
  • Covers a wide range of academic subjects
  • Accessible on multiple platforms
Cons
  • Can take time to get used to the Picmonic style
  • May not suit all learning styles
  • Mobile app has limited features compared to web version
  • Can be expensive compared to other study tools
